AMERISAFE, Inc. is an insurance holding company that underwrites workers' compensation insurance across the United States. AMERISAFE serves small to mid-sized employers engaged in hazardous industries, such as construction, trucking, logging and lumber, agriculture, manufacturing, telecommunications, and maritime, and has been incorporated since 1985, with its headquarters located in DeRidder, Louisiana. DERIDDER, La.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--AMERISAFE, Inc. (Nasdaq: AMSF) (the “Company”), a specialty provider of workers' compensation insurance focused on high hazard industries, today announced that Anastasios Omiridis, the Company's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er has notified the Company of his intent to resign, effective November 30, 2025, to pursue another opportunity.
